WebAfter Heyward wrote the novel Porgy in 1925, his wife Dorothy wrote a play based on the novel also entitled Porgy, which opened in 1927 as a Broadway Theatre Guild production. The play was directed by Rouben Mamoulian, who later directed the 1935 production of the opera, Porgy and Bess , and was originally hired to direct the 1959 film. Porgy is a novel written by the American author DuBose Heyward and published by the George H. Doran Company in 1925. The novel tells the story of Porgy, a crippled street beggar living in the black tenements of Charleston, South Carolina, in the 1920s. The character was based on Charlestonian Samuel Smalls.
